Sick New World Unveils Massive 2026 Lineups and Announces Second Festival in Texas
After a brief hiatus, the Sick New World festival is making a colossal return in 2026, announcing its lineup for the flagship Las Vegas event and revealing a major expansion with a second, distinct festival set for Texas.
The original Sick New World will take place on Saturday, April 25, 2026, at the Las Vegas Festival Grounds. The festival will be headlined by System Of A Down and Korn, with support from an immense roster of bands including Bring Me The Horizon, Evanescence, Marilyn Manson, Ministry, AFI, Cypress Hill, and Knocked Loose.
For the first time ever, the festival will debut Sick New World Texas on Saturday, October 24, 2026, at the Texas Motor Speedway in Fort Worth, Texas. This inaugural Lone Star State event will feature a slightly different lineup, with headlining performances from System Of A Down, Deftones, and a special appearance by Slayer, who will be celebrating the 40th anniversary of their landmark album, Reign in Blood. Other notable acts on the Texas bill include Evanescence, The Prodigy, Marilyn Manson, Ministry, and AFI.
Presale for the Las Vegas event begins Thursday, October 23, at 10 a.m. PT, with the Texas presale following on Friday, October 24, at 10 a.m. CT.
